
Overview of air cooled chiller Refrigeration Systems
Air cooled chiller refrigeration systems are crucial in various industrial and commercial applications where cooling is essential. These systems utilize air as a coolant instead of water, making them ideal for locations where water availability is limited or where water costs are high. This type of chiller is particularly popular for its efficiency and ease of installation.
The fundamental operation of an air cooled chiller involves the extraction of heat from a fluid through a vapor-compression or absorption refrigeration cycle. The chilled fluid can then be circulated to cool down processes, machinery, or indoor environments. With advancements in technology, modern air cooled chillers are designed to be more energy-efficient and environmentally friendly, featuring improved refrigerants and innovative designs.

Key Features of High-Quality Air Cooled Chillers
High-quality air cooled chillers come equipped with several key features that enhance their performance and longevity. One significant feature is the use of advanced compressor technology, which helps improve energy efficiency and reduce operational costs. Variable speed compressors are increasingly common, adjusting their output based on cooling demand.
Another essential feature is the integration of smart controls and monitoring systems. These technologies allow for real-time tracking of system performance, enabling operators to make informed decisions and optimize energy usage. Additionally, durable materials and construction are critical for withstanding harsh environmental conditions, ensuring the chiller operates effectively over its lifespan.

Future Trends in Air Cooled Chiller Technology
The future of air cooled chiller technology looks promising, with ongoing innovations aimed at enhancing efficiency and sustainability. The shift towards eco-friendly refrigerants is gaining momentum, driven by environmental regulations and growing awareness of climate change. Manufacturers are exploring alternatives that minimize greenhouse gas emissions while maintaining performance standards.
Moreover, the integration of IoT (Internet of Things) capabilities into air cooled chillers is set to revolutionize the industry. Smart technology allows for predictive maintenance, remote monitoring, and automated control, improving operational efficiency and reducing downtime. As these trends continue to evolve, the air cooled chiller market will likely see significant advancements in both technology and design.
